RadNet (NASDAQ:RDNT) Downgraded by StockNews.com to Sell

StockNews.com cut shares of RadNet (NASDAQ:RDNTFree Report) from a hold rating to a sell rating in a report released on Thursday.

Separately, Truist Financial started coverage on RadNet in a research report on Thursday, August 31st. They set a buy rating and a $40.00 price objective on the stock.

RadNet Stock Down 0.6 %

Shares of RDNT opened at $30.75 on Thursday. The company has a current ratio of 1.39, a quick ratio of 1.39 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.11. RadNet has a 12 month low of $12.03 and a 12 month high of $35.18. The stock’s 50 day moving average is $32.11 and its two-hundred day moving average is $28.89. The firm has a market cap of $2.08 billion, a P/E ratio of -123.00 and a beta of 1.68.

RadNet (NASDAQ:RDNTG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Tuesday, August 8th. The medical research company reported $0.24 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.07 by $0.17. The business had revenue of $403.70 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$389.29 million. RadNet had a positive return on equity of 3.98% and a negative net margin of 0.84%. The business’s quarterly revenue was up 13.9%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$0.15 earnings per share. Analysts predict that RadNet will post 0.38 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About RadNet

(Get Free Report)

RadNet,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ides outpatient diagnostic imaging services in the United States. The company operates in two segments: Imaging Centers and Artificial Intelligence. Its services include magnetic resonance imaging, computed tomography, positron emission tomography, nuclear medicine, mammography, ultrasound, diagnostic radiology, fluoroscopy, and other related procedures, as well as multi-modality imaging services.
